Today is Sunday the 5th of May 2024 07:43:52


  • Dictionary

    Word: Ovipositor

    ID Word Wordtype Definition
    107959 Ovipositor n. The organ with which many insects and some other animals deposit their eggs. Some ichneumon files have a long ovipositor fitted to pierce the eggs or larvae of other insects, in order to lay their own eggs within the same.

    Do you know these words?

    Turrel | Orator | Mesoblast | Melanotype | Psycho-motor |